2002 Mazda MPV: Heater Low Circuit?

Error code  P0037, H025, BANK 1 SENSOR 2, HEATER CIRCUIT LOW.


This is the O2 sensor located behind the Cat on the back side of the engine exhaust manifold.

To determine if the heater is bad, a resistance reading can be made on the heater pins at the plug to the O2. These would be the connectors that the Light Green and Black/White wire on the engine harness connect too. There should be resistance of 14.2 to 18.9 ohms. Anything more or less of these values, replace the O2.


And in case of P0031, HO2S Bank 1 Sen 1
Heater Circuit Low
The firewall side of the engine is Bank 1 for the MPV, the radiator side is Bank 2. So that code is pointing to a problem in the heater circuit for the sensor near the firewall before the convertor. You can check resistance of the heater circuit of the sensor. If should have 5-7 ohms, if not then the sensor is definitely bad.

 P0031 H02S BANK 1 SEN 1, HEATER CIRCUIT LOW, WHERE IS THIS SENSOR LOCATED AND IS IT UPSTREAM OR DOWNSTREAM.

THe Oxygen Sensor at Bank1 Sensor1 is mounted to the exhaust manifold on the side of the engine closest to the firewall. This is a "Sensor 1" so it is labeled as an "Upstream" sensor.

Heated Oxygen Sensors (HO2S) OPERATION TESTING ,REMOVAL and INSTALLATION?

OPERATION



See Figures 1 and 2

The oxygen sensor supplies the computer with a signal which indicates a rich or lean condition during engine operation. The input information assists the computer in determining the proper air/fuel ratio. A low voltage signal from the sensor indicates too much oxygen in the exhaust (lean condition) and, conversely, a high voltage signal indicates too little oxygen in the exhaust (rich condition).

The oxygen sensors are threaded into the exhaust manifold and/or exhaust pipes on all vehicles. Heated oxygen sensors are used on all models to allow the engine to reach the closed loop faster.

TESTING




WARNING
Do not pierce the wires when testing this sensor; this can lead to wiring harness damage. Back probe the connector to properly read the voltage of the HO2S.

  1. Disconnect the HO2S.
  2. Measure the resistance between PWR and GND terminals of the sensor. If the reading is approximately 6 ohms at 68°F (1°C). the sensor's heater element is in good condition.
  3. With the HO2S connected and engine running, measure the voltage with a Digital Volt-Ohmmeter (DVOM) between terminals HO2S and SIG RTN(GND) of the oxygen sensor connector. If the voltage readings are swinging rapidly between 0.01-1.1 volts, the sensor is probably okay.

REMOVAL & INSTALLATION



See Figures 3 and 4

1996-99 Explorer/Mountaineers use four heated oxygen sensors (HO2S), and V6 equipped Rangers use three HO2S's, and 2.3L and 2.5L engines use two HO2S's for the engine control system. The heated sensors are located before and after the dual converters in the exhaust pipes. On 5.0L and 1991-95 engines V6 engines, there are two sensors, one is located in the left exhaust manifold and the other in the dual converter Y-pipe. 1991-95 2.3L engines use only one sensor.

  1. Disconnect the negative battery cable.
  2. Raise and safely support the vehicle on jackstands.

  1. Disconnect the HO2S from the engine control sensor wiring.

If excessive force is needed to remove the sensors, lubricate the sensor with penetrating oil prior to removal.

  1. Remove the sensors with a sensor removal tool, such as Ford Tool T94P-9472-A.

To install:
  1. Install the sensor in the mounting boss, then tighten it to 27-33 ft. lbs. (37-45 Nm).
  2. Reattach the sensor electrical wiring connector to the engine wiring harness.
  3. Lower the vehicle.
  4. Connect the negative battery cable.
